Title: Thomas J Mach: Innovator in Jet Fuel Additives
Introduction
Thomas J Mach is a notable inventor based in Warwick, NY (US), recognized for his contributions to the field of jet fuel technology. With a total of 2 patents to his name, he has made significant advancements that enhance the performance and stability of jet fuels.
Latest Patents
Among his latest patents, Mach has developed thermal stability additives for jet fuels. This innovation involves a liquid jet fuel composition that improves the overall performance of jet fuels. Additionally, he has patented a process for making copolymers for viscosity index improvers. This method includes a one-step reaction involving ethylene, an olefin other than ethylene, and N-phenylphenylene methacrylamide, utilizing a specific cocatalyst system.
